In the past few days, the biggest verified Gwen Stefani development has been the close of No Doubt’s Las Vegas Sphere run, which included a final onstage family moment with her sons and a wave of fan reaction around the residency’s ending, a milestone that matters biographically because it reinforces her ongoing identity as both a solo star and the frontwoman of a major reunion act. Reports circulating in entertainment coverage also say the residency positioned her as the first female headliner at the Sphere with No Doubt, which, if fully confirmed in broader trade coverage, would be a career landmark rather than just a concert booking.[7][10] The most visible recent public moment tied to Stefani was her surprise onstage appearance with Olivia Rodrigo, which fans and entertainment posts have been sharing heavily online; the reaction suggests the moment landed as a cross generational pop culture flashpoint, though the social chatter itself is not a substitute for full reporting. Rolling Stone is referenced in the reposted material as noting that the surprise came right after the release of Rodrigo related music, but that detail is only secondhand here and should be treated as unconfirmed until matched by the original report.[2][4][8] There is also renewed attention on Stefani and Blake Shelton after a recent entertainment story said Shelton publicly supporting Stefani during the No Doubt residency made a bigger impression than many fans realized. That is more gossip adjacent than career changing, but it keeps their marriage and joint public image in the news, especially because fan posts and rumor style accounts are again pushing relationship speculation online without solid evidence of any real drama.[1][6][12] On social media, the strongest verified pattern is simple: Stefani keeps surfacing in clips and fan posts tied to the residency, the Olivia Rodrigo moment, and the broader No Doubt nostalgia cycle, while her personal accounts continue to project a polished, low drama image.
